What Is ARD Expungement? Am I Eligible?

If you are a first-time DUI offender, you may be eligible for Pennsylvania’s accelerated rehabilitative disposition program (ARD). This program was designed to make the court process more efficient and give people a second chance to have a clean criminal record.

You Have 30 Days To Take Advantage Of The ARD Program

The ARD expungement program in Pennsylvania offers a great opportunity for individuals to have their DUI/DWI charge completely wiped from their record criminal record. Timing is very critical since individuals only have 30 days to file for admittance. Also, first-time offenders are the only people who are eligible for consideration into this program.

What Should You Expect In The ARD Program?

When you retain the services of Mr. Lauer, he will guide you through the entire ARD expungement process. There are many requirements that must be completed on time if you wish for your record to be free from your DUI charge. While you do not have to serve jail time, you will have to be on probation for an extended period of time and complete other required conditions.
